Aprilia rider Marco Bezzecchi stole the spotlight by clinching pole position at his home MotoGP race in Misano.

“Marco Bezzecchi clinched pole position at the Misano MotoGP race, setting a new lap record of 1.30.134s.

Alex Marquez took second place as the top Ducati finisher, surpassing his previous struggles at the track.

Fabio Quartararo qualified third, with Marc Marquez in fourth and Franco Morbidelli in fifth.

Francesco Bagnaia faced struggles in eighth place, while Pedro Acosta finished ninth after a crash.

Jorge Martin secured 11th place and Joan Mir will start 12th without setting a time.

A tight battle saw Miguel Oliveira in 13th, while Brad Binder and Maverick Vinales placed 16th and 17th.

Enea Bastianini’s race ended abruptly in 20th place, and Jack Miller qualified 21st for Pramac Yamaha.”
